Volvo returns to Sarawak

By CARSIFU | 17 December 2018


KUCHING: Volvo Car Malaysia, together with its appointed dealer, Fotroende Automobile, marked a return into Sarawak after an absence of a decade with the grand opening of Volvo Kuching – a full-fledged 3S centre (Sales, Service, and Spare Parts) located along Jalan Tun Jugah.

The launch ceremony was officiated by the Managing Director of Volvo Car Malaysia, Lennart Stegland who impressed on the importance of Sarawak for the future growth of the brand.

“Sarawak’s potential in the premium car market cannot be understated. It is vital that we regain a foothold in Kuching before expanding into other cities within the state. We have worked hard to ensure that the brand is represented by competent and passionate dealer partners that will serve our customers well.”

Like all Volvo dealerships, Volvo Kuching will adhere to the latest showroom and service standards which Volvo terms “Volvo Retail Experience” or VRE – a customer-centric, Scandinavian-inspired experience that is cool on the outside and warm on the inside.

“VRE is based on Volvo’s brand philosophy which revolves around people and what’s important to them. I am confident that Fotroende Automobile will deliver the expected level of service to our loyal customers in Kuching,” Stegland added.

The company’s name (Fotroende Automobile) is derived from the Swedish word “Förtroende” which means “confidence”.

“Demand for the brand is strong, especially with the arrival of exciting new models from Volvo. We are proud that have been chosen by Volvo Car Malaysia to represent the brand here in Kuching,” said Managing Director of Fotroende Automobile, David Lai.
